2 students are playing Rock, Paper, Scissors.
Find the theoretical probability that player A does Paper.

Respuesta :

IjlalHashmi
IjlalHashmi IjlalHashmi
  • 11-12-2020

Answer:

1/3

Step-by-step explanation:

Since there are three option for Player A to choose which are

Rock , Paper , Scissors

The probability he choose paper is 1/3 , because

there are total three options so the denominator is the total number of outcomes which are 3, and the numerator is the outcome he choose which is paper it means he chooses one outcome so hence the probability of Player A choosing paper is 1/3
